Miniature Heat Pipes for Thermal Control of Radio-Electronic Equipment
RESUMO
The regularities of heat and mass transfer processes in miniature heat pipes (MHP), used for thermal control of radio-electronic equipment (REE), have been studied within a broad range of operating parameters with regard to their structural and design features; a method for MHP analysis has been developed. The results of an experimental study of the developed new designs of heat pipes are presented.
